What is the difference between the series 2 and series 3 engines? I just picked up a L67 series 3 from a 2004 grand prix gtp. Hoping to use it for a project I have going with a rear wheel drive conversion with a 5 speed. Any advice or help will be appreciated.

From the research I did a while back.
Series 3
N/a engines went to aluminum upper intake
Heads- intake port improvements and intake valves are 1.83 vs 1.80 on series 2. the exhaust valve is also slightly larger but this was done on some of the later series 2 also
Series 3 all drive by wire no throttle cable
Series 3 has a returnless fuel injection system (no return line)
Connecting rods were improved on 2004 and later supercharged 2005 and later n/a
And all the series 3 supercharged got the gen 5 blower

Series 3 n/a code is l26 supercharged is l32

That's what i remember from the research i did hope it helps
